A mounting device (100) for installation on a hollow rib of a panel is disclosed. The mounting device (100) includes a mounting body (102), an insert (160), and at least one clamping fastener (180). The mounting body (102) includes an upper section or base (104), along with a first leg (112) and a second leg (122) that each extend downwardly from the base (104) in at least generally diverging relation to one another. The first leg (112) includes a first projection (116) positionable in a recess on one sidewall of a rib, while the insert (160) includes a second projection (164) positionable in a recess on the opposite sidewall of this same rib. The clamping fastener(s) (180) extends through the second leg (122) of the mounting body (102) and forces the insert (160) in the direction of the first leg (112) of the mounting body (102).

1. A method of installing a mounting device on a rib of a building surface, comprising the steps of: positioning a first projection of a mounting body of a mounting device within a first recess on a first sidewall of a first rib, wherein said mounting body comprises a first leg and a second leg that are spaced from one another in an end view of said mounting body, and wherein said first leg comprises said first projection;positioning a second projection of an insert of said mounting device within a second recess on a second sidewall of said first rib, wherein said insert and said mounting body are separate parts;executing a first moving step comprising moving said mounting body either clockwise or counterclockwise about a first reference axis in said end view of said mounting body, relative to each of said first rib and said insert of said mounting device, and with said first projection of said mounting body remaining within said first recess of said first rib throughout said first moving step, wherein said first reference axis coincides with said first projection of said mounting body and a length dimension of said mounting body;contacting said insert with said mounting body during said first moving step;executing a second moving step comprising moving said insert about said second projection of said insert and relative to said first rib; anddirecting at least one threaded fastener through said mounting body and into engagement with said insert to force said insert against said second sidewall of said first rib;wherein after said mounting device is in an installed configuration relative to said first rib: 1) said first leg of said mounting body is positioned alongside at least an upper portion said first sidewall of said first rib; 2) said second leg of said mounting body is positioned alongside at least an upper portion of said second sidewall of said first rib; and 3) said insert is located between said second sidewall of said first rib and said second leg of said mounting body. 2.
